The health department has logged eight inspections at Panera Bread, the earliest from 2022. Inspectors last stopped by on Jan 5, 2026. The medium risk tier sits in the middle: not spotless, but not alarming either.

Violation counts have held steady across recent visits, averaging around one violation each.

“Sanitizers criteria-chemicals” accounts for the largest share of issues, appearing two times across the record.

Compared to other Boston restaurants (averaging 86), there's room to close the gap. The record is unremarkable in either direction.

Inspection History
Jan 5, 2026
Routine
1 critical violation. 1 major violation. 1 minor violation.
View 3 violations
Sanitizers criteria-chemicals (p)
Inspector notes: Chlorine at low temperature warewashing machine tested at over 200ppm with health inspector's and location's test strips; a service call was placed to repair warewashing machine and location will use their three compartment sink to wash wares until that point. Sanitizer from low temperature warewashing machine should be at manafactuerer's instructions concentration.
590.007/7-204.11-P
(a)-(p) person-in-charge-duties (pf)
Inspector notes: The designated person in charge was not able to provide answers regarding proper cold holding hot holding cooling and illness policy. Provide a person in charge that is knowlegable about food safety and illness policy.
590.002(D)/2-103.11-PF
(a) certified food protection manager (c)
Inspector notes: There is no certified food protection manager certificate posted; provide and post CFPM certificate.
590.002(C)/2-102.12-C
